In the Resync_Periodic parameter enter a small value for testing such as 30
(meaning 30 seconds).
Click Submit all Changes.
With the new parameter settings, the IP Telephony Device now resyncs to the
configuration file specified by the URL twice a minute.
Observe the resulting messages in the syslog trace.
Ensure that the Resync_On_Reset parameter is set to yes.
Power cycle the IP Telephony Device.
The IP Telephony Device also automatically resyncs to the provisioning server
whenever it is power-cycled.
If the resync operation fails for any reason, such as if the server is not responding,
the unit waits the number of seconds defined in Resync_Error_Retry_Delay before
attempting to resync again. If Resync_Error_Retry_Delay is zero, the IP Telephony
Device does not try to resync following a failed resync attempt.
(Optional) Verify that the value of Resync_Error_Retry_Delay is set to a small
number, such as 30, disable the TFTP server, and observe the results in the syslog
output.

Unique Profiles and Macro Expansion

In a large deployment, each IP Telephony Device needs to be configured with
distinct values for specific parameters, such as User_ID or Display_Name. To meet
this requirement, the service provider must generate distinct profiles, one for each
deployed device. Each IP Telephony Device, in turn, must be configured to resync
to its own profile, according to some predetermined profile naming convention.
The profile URL syntax can include identifying information specific to each IP
Telephony Device (such as MAC address and serial number) via macro expansion
of built-in variables. This eliminates the need to specify these values within each
profile.
